**UPDATE** As of 10:15 AM, the Chief reported Leighton Road is back open to traffic

We began receiving reports from listeners just after 9:00 Thursday morning that there was a large emergency response followed by partial road closures near Leighton Road in Augusta.

After reaching out directly to Augusta Fire Chief, Dave Groder, it can be confirmed that crews were responding to a house fire on the Leighton Road.

Chief Groder also tells Townsquare Media that though no people were injured in the fire, one pet did pass away.
